What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Machine Operator,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Machine Operator, you need mechanical aptitude, basic math skills, attention to detail, and typically a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with industrial machinery, safety protocols, and sometimes certifications in forklift operation or OSHA compliance are important. Strong problem-solving, teamwork, and communication skills help you respond quickly to issues and coordinate with colleagues. These skills ensure safe, efficient, and high-quality production in manufacturing environments.

What are machine operators?

Machine operators are skilled workers responsible for operating, maintaining, and monitoring machinery in a manufacturing or production setting. They ensure that machines run efficiently, make adjustments as needed, and perform routine inspections to prevent malfunctions. Machine operators often work with a variety of equipment, follow safety protocols, and may also assist in troubleshooting and minor repairs. Their role is essential for keeping production lines running smoothly and producing quality products.

What are some common challenges faced by machine operators, and how can they be addressed?

Machine operators often encounter challenges such as equipment malfunctions, maintaining quality standards under tight deadlines, and adapting to new technologies or processes. To address these issues, operators should follow regular maintenance schedules, participate in ongoing training, and communicate proactively with maintenance teams and supervisors. Developing strong troubleshooting skills and staying updated on safety protocols also help ensure efficient and safe operations.
